the site is HUGE. Get an EXPO taxi (green/yellow) to drive your right to the ticket entrance (these are the ONLY taxi's allowed to go that far), and plan on walking exteriors, enjoying food snacks from different countries. All the reviews about lines and line cutting are true. Know that, expect that and deal with it or stay home. I stayed away from any line over 30 minutes and if you plan and understand the best times to visit you can see many of the pavilions. The evening quiets down however some pavilions close early.
